Contents: Kit to create the old Cape Cod Canel Bascule Bridge which crosses the cape Cod Canel before being replaced by the newer lift span. You can also use this kit to place old style bascule bridges across canels, channels, or other routes using any of the four single or double track in newly painted black or neglected rust. Approach wood viaducts and end piers are included. TSModeler parts included.

Note, you will need texture files from SRV_CTex.zip, SRVblack.zip, and SRVRusty.zip as only one custom texture is provided in this download.

to install:
1: unzip to a temp folder with "use folder names" on.

2: go to folder where you unziped the files to and copy and paste the .s and .sd files from the Shapes folder to the Shapes folder of the route you wish to use them in.

3: copy the CapeCodBridgeMisc.ace from the texture folder to the texture folder of your route. For TSModeler and other 3-d modeling program, copy CapeCodBridgeMisc.bmp and place it in a folder where your 3-d program can find it.

You need the following textures from the SRVRusty.zip;
	SRV_Bridges4.ace
	SRV_Bridge4a.ace

Also, the following common textures from the SRV_CTex.zip
	Srv_RealTinSiding.ace
	SRV_ConcretePier.ace
	SRV_WoodBridge.ace
	SRV_Terrain.ace
	SRV_StonePier.ace if you plan to use the stone end pier

4: BACKUP the .REF file for the route (normaly ROUTE-NAME.ref  EG: marias.ref) to a safe place.

5: go to folder where you unziped the files to and open "Bascule.ref" with WORDPAD and copy and paste ALL THE TEXT from  Bascule.ref to the .ref file of the route REMEMBER TO SAVE IT AS "UNICODE TEXT".

The parts will be found in the "Bridge" class.

Note; To assemble the wood viaduct for the twin track, position each single viaduct and line up the track to the track on the bridge. Select both object using Ctrl left mouse click. If you need to rotate the viaduct to place the double piling section closest to the bridge, the best way to do this is with both selected. Use Ctrl C to copy both viaduct sections at once. Move to the other end and place in position. By keeping both sections selected, it will be easier to handle twin viaducts this way.
